Dell SWOT Analysis

Dell Inc is one of the larges multinational technology corporation that develops, manufacture, sell and support personal computer, laptops and other computer peripherals.

Strength

•    Customer oriented marketing strategies.

•    Well-Known for online selling of Computers.

•    Listed in the fortune 500 companies as the 25th largest company.

•    Dell Company employs more than 76000 thousand people.

•    Provide quality PCs, Laptops and computer peripherals at low price.

•    Low manufacturing cost.

•    Dell offer computers with AMD and Dell processor.

•    Dell has nine of manufacturing plants.

•    24X 7 Customer support.

•    Offer wide range of PC, Server, Laptops, Monitors and LCDs, Data storage devices, network switches and software.

•    Dell built computer on customer provided specifications.

•    Dell always keen to embed latest technology in its products.

•    It has a reliable support and service.

•    The company website at least receives 25 million visits.

•    Efficient Inventory management.

•    Dell became the first company in the information technology industry to establish a product-recycling goal.

Weaknesses

•    Elimination of bonuses in 2006 to increase the company financial performance.

•    Closure of Dell’s biggest call center in April, 2003 terminating 1100 employees.

•    On January 8, 2009 Dell announced the closing of its manufacturing plant in Limerick, Ireland with the loss of 1,900 jobs and the shift of production to its plant in Poland.

•    Dell not able to attract the students of schools and colleges,   this segment earn only 5% of total revenues.

•    Lot of criticism against the Dell’s claim of world’s most secured notebooks.

•    Dell willingly discontinued the “world’s most secure laptops” advertisement after the declaration of the NAD investigation.

•    Dell have no proprietary technology, the currently used technology by dell are shared by the other major competitors.

•    Dell is dependent on its suppliers

Opportunities

•    India, Pakistan and Bangladesh are the untapped markets.

•    Market penetration in education and Government markets.

•    Cost reduction in latest technology.

•    Partnership or acquiring of suppliers.

•    Dell has opportunity to sell computer directly to retailers.

Threats

•    Fluctuation in currency outside US.

•    Major competitors in the market.

•    Most of the countries are hit by recession which may result in the reduction of revenues.

•    Government Policies.

•    Bargaining of Suppliers.

•    Rapid change in technology obsoletes the product in small span of time.

•    Aggressive marketing by competitors.
